Claimant was employed as Deputy Sheriff and head matron in the Cedar Street Jail by the County of Onondaga. She resided in an apartment in the jail building and, in addition to her salary as added compensation, she was provided with living quarters and board. She worked seven days a week and was subject to 24-hour call, and her work consisted of supervision of the women matrons and the female side of the jail, in addition to the preparation...
